Folders are not responding in my WD Passport 2 TB External Hardisk (bought before 3 months)..

When i had a problem for the first time i was not able to view my hardisk in explorer..
Now the hardisk is visible, but i am not able to explore my folders and not able to copy or recover my files.. I am totally struck with my hardisk.. I need a way to restore my hardisk or recover my files before going for replacement.. Help me out..

I'm really sorry for that.

I guess you should contact our Support either by e-mail or phone and eventually RMA the drive.
Apart from that, you can try some data recovery software(you can try several as well). Just keep in mind not to save any recovered data on the same HDD but on another one. Check this out: http://www.tomshardware.co.uk/forum/id-1644496/lost-data-recovery.html
If you can't retrieve anything with recovery software, then I guess you should try running the chkdsk/r C: (C being the letter of the drive). Just keep in mind that if the issue you are facing is caused by bad sectors, you may loose the data on these particular sectors while using this command.
